Output 6515667dfa654385159f93e44caf17fe2b0027aa2ee55c575497b5cb4083ce31:0

value
665086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fc71812c0a40e157b89fd66d27f5d1138e6dbe OP_EQUAL
address
3HTgZcSojAXdNDkVgsnx1inkJA7PPeqsZz
transaction
6515667dfa654385159f93e44caf17fe2b0027aa2ee55c575497b5cb4083ce31